Description

This deciduous shrub displays attractive leaves with a fresh green colour tinted with soft pink hues as they mature. It produces fluffy, pink-tinged flower panicles in summer, adding interest and texture.

It grows well in full sun or partial shade in well-drained soils. The plant is hardy in the UK and can be used in borders or as a specimen plant for seasonal colour.
